Laraine Newman to Perform with Ann Randolph at The Marsh in February

Laraine Newman, one of the original members of both The Groundlings and Saturday Night Live, will perform The Audition as part of a benefit for The Marsh, during the re-opening weekend (February 4 & 5) of Ann Randolph’s solo show, Loveland, which runs through February 26.

Newman’s piece is about her delightful escapades in the wonderful world of seeking work in her chosen field. Randolph’s show recounts the emotional, hilarious and deeply human journey of Frannie Potts, an out of control, sexually charged misfit who is never shy to speak her mind.

The return engagement of Loveland, directed by Matt Roth, replaces the previously announced run of Dan Hoyle’s The Real Americans, which has been postponed until the spring due to an injury sustained by the writer/performer.
